    Getting There

    Bus

    Take local bus services from Llandudno town center to stops near the Great Orme or promenade area; journey times range from 10 to 20 minutes with frequent daily departures; single fares cost approximately £2-£3.

    Walking

    From Llandudno town center, a scenic walk of about 20 to 30 minutes along the promenade and coastal paths leads to View Point; terrain is mostly flat and accessible, suitable for most fitness levels.

    Taxi

    Local taxis can provide a direct and quick 5 to 10-minute ride from central Llandudno to View Point; fares typically range from £5 to £10 depending on time of day and traffic.

    Discover more about View Point

    Captivating Coastal Vistas

    View Point in Llandudno is renowned for its breathtaking panoramic views that stretch across the Irish Sea and the charming Victorian town below. Positioned to capture the sweeping coastline, this lookout spot offers visitors a chance to immerse themselves in the natural beauty of North Wales. The expansive sea views are complemented by the sight of the Great Orme and Little Orme headlands, iconic limestone formations that frame the bay and add dramatic contours to the landscape.

    Connection to Llandudno’s Seaside Charm

    Situated near the heart of Llandudno, View Point complements the town’s reputation as a classic British seaside resort. Llandudno itself is celebrated for its elegant Victorian architecture, extensive promenade, and historic pier. Visitors to View Point can easily combine their visit with excursions to nearby highlights such as the Great Orme Tramway, the bustling promenade, or the sandy and pebbled beaches that line the town.

    Local Wildlife and Natural Features

    The surrounding area is part of a protected natural landscape, with local flora and fauna adding to the scenic appeal. Birdwatchers may spot seabirds soaring above, while the nearby coastal paths provide opportunities to explore diverse habitats. The limestone geology of the Great Orme nearby is a reminder of the region’s rich natural history, adding depth to the visitor experience.
